hulky (comparative more hulky, superlative most hulky)
- Large; hulking.
- 2009 March 22, Susanna Hamner, “Harley, You’re Not Getting Any Younger”, New York Times:
- After riding high for two decades, the company that makes the hulky bikes that devoted riders affectionately call Hogs is sputtering.
